SPA To Host Dylan Mulvaney Lecture December 5

Penn State’s Student Programming Association (SPA) will host actress and social media influencer Dylan Mulvaney for a moderated conversation and question-and-answer session at 7 p.m. on Tuesday, December 5, in the HUB’s Alumni Hall.

Mulvaney’s first major acting role was Elder White in the “Book of Mormon” Broadway musical, which kickstarted her career. She began making TikTok content in March 2022 with her “Days of Girlhood” series that documented her gender transition and garnered nearly a billion views online.

Since then, Mulvaney has been invited to the White House to speak with President Joe Biden about transgender rights and has continued to use her platform for activism and awareness of transgender issues.

Mulvaney has received numerous awards for her use of her following, including being featured on Rolling Stone’s creator list, and Fast Company’s Queer 50 list.

Tickets for the event will be available at 7 p.m. on Friday, December 1, through OrgCentral.
